The British Sugarcraft Guild was inaugurated officially on 17th March 1981 with the first meeting of the steering committee. Their backgrounds varied but these enthusiastic cake decorators were united firmly by their love of the art of sugarcraft.
With a swan and its reflection as a logo a Newsletter for new members and its motto 'My Craft is my Art' the British Sugarcraft Guild was born.
The aims and objectives of the Guild are to:
* Promote and stimulate interest in sugarcraft;
* Share knowledge;
* Develop talent;
* Improve standards.
There are 136 branches throughout the country. Most meet on a regular basis and it's a way to meet new and old friends. In addition to meeting people, most branches invite a demonstrator to come along and demonstrate a number of skills or tasks.
